And because they hold more water fascia style gutters can made narrower and thus less obtrusive and noticeable and still perform as well as k style gutters.

Fascia style rain gutters.

It has a higher capacity than a typical 5 inch k style gutter and attaches with a heavy duty steel hidden fascia hanger. Our steel gutters are designed to integrate into the home s soffit and fascia system helping create a cohesive appearance to the exterior components. These gutters come in 26 guage pre painted steel and 16oz or 20oz copper. Plus the double flow capacity of our optional downspouts and extensions reduces the possibility of your gutters overflowing clogging or flooding by directing water away from your home s foundation.

Proponents of fascia style gutters say the profile holds more water since the trough is boxy rather than curved. Seamless fascia style rain gutter installation. Before the late 19th century were made of wood and were cut or carved into a variety of shapes from simple boxy channels to those having more ornamental carved facades. There are many rain gutter styles rain gutter types or guttering profiles and shapes available.

Increased water capacity abc fascia gutters can carry up to 33 percent more water than the conventional 5 inch k style gutter. It is available in galvalume aluminum and copper materials and a variety of different colors. The fascia gutter profile is very common on residential homes in northern california and the north west. They encompass the entire height of the fascia.

Fascia style gutters are a very popular style mostly used on new construction. It is most commonly found in the western part of the united states. K shape gutters can carry more water than half round gutters. Fascia gutters are commonly seen on commercial and heavy residential buildings.

Fascia gutters differ from k style gutters because of their distinctive flat front. It is often a custom made gutter that is fixed to the ends of the rafters and also performs the function of a fascia board. This can be a better option for buildings that have unique architectural qualities. They are 6 inches deep and are fixed directly to the fascia board.

Due to the creases that runs the length k shape gutters are structurally strong. Many homeowners choose abc seamless fascia style gutters for several other reasons as well. Many of the earliest rain gutters in the u s. It is approximately 3 inches deeper than the common 5k style gutter so it covers more or even the entire fascia board giving the home a completly different look.

The 5 1 2 fascia gutter is the most common rain gutter we install. At 5 1 2 deep this gutter is designed to cover a 2 x 4 rafter tail. Fascia shape gutters can be difficult to clean due to their increased depth.
